Peache said:
Thanks for your help in contacting Supercard..

No worries at all,

Got a reply back from Team SuperCard here is the email:

"This is cause by DSTWO hardware individual differences, the booting time of DSTWO boot up code still be too slow, some cards can not cross, and now to find a ways to speed up the boot code."

From this it sounds like they are working on it and that there are some slight differences in the hardware used throughout the SuperCards lifespan. However the SuperCards stocked by Modariffic have been the same as some new ones have been tested in the meantime and work with the 3DS as well.

So because of the boot time being too slow on older units there will be some tweaks made to hopefully get the card up and running for you (and others) experiencing this unfortunate problem.

I have emailed back to see if there is an ETA on this but teams should never be rushed in this situation, its best to wait this one out
wink.gif


Hope this helps!

.Finally, I went to the shop where I got my SC DS2 and they replaced it for a new one. The sticker is different from the one I had, so we could confirm what SC Team answered - the old ones boot time is slower and that makes the error to show up.

Fully working on my 3DS now, at last.
